The Bulldogs picked up a win over the rival Northwestern State Demons 7-2 Tuesday night.

Louisiana Tech's Kody Neel got the Bulldogs on the board first following a two-run double in the bottom of the 1st inning. Tech scored four runs in the frame to take an early 4-0 lead.

The 'Dawgs did not look back. They scored three more runs in the bottom of the 7th inning, to make the score 7-1.

The Demons' Cort Brinson brought home Todd Wallace after his double down the right field line in the top of the 6th.

Northwestern State was able to squeeze in one more run in the top of the 8th when Matt Baca singled to center to send home Matt Farmer.

Out of the seven pitchers the Demons used in the contest, Dillon Crain was tagged with the loss. Crain allowed three hits, three walks, and four runs.

The Bulldogs get their 19th victory of the season, while the Demons drop to 15-38 on the year.
